Tesla is embarking on a new venture by offering rides in driverless Model Y SUVs in Austin, a significant development in their long-anticipated journey toward making autonomous rides a reality. This initiative marks a pivotal moment in Tesla’s trajectory, especially considering that CEO Elon Musk has made numerous promises over the past decade regarding the advent of self-driving cars.
This rollout represents a critical test of Musk’s hypothesis that fully autonomous vehicles can be safely deployed using an approach that relies solely on cameras and advanced artificial intelligence. This method diverges significantly from techniques adopted by other players in the autonomous vehicle market, such as Waymo, which employs an array of sensors, including lidar and radar, to navigate complex real-world environments.
### Launching a New Era in Transportation
Videos circulating on social media and reports from local sources confirm that the long-awaited rides are finally underway. Remarkably, the rides are priced at a flat fee of $4.20—a detail that has not gone unnoticed, considering Musk’s previous penchant for promoting numbers with cultural significance. Just a week before the official launch, Tesla dispatched invitations to select early-access users, allowing them to download a new robotaxi app to hail rides.
The exact number of individuals selected for this early access remains uncertain, though it seems many invitations were extended to Tesla’s most passionate supporters. Notably, posts on Musk’s social media platform, X, showcase excitement from these early adopters as they share their experiences using the app designed specifically for hailing Tesla’s robotaxis.
According to the information released on Tesla’s updated website, the service is set to operate daily from 6:00 a.m. to midnight, although it might be curtailed during inclement weather. Each ride will feature a Tesla employee in the front passenger seat, serving as a “safety monitor”—a move that underscores the company’s cautious approach to rolling out this innovative service.
### Challenges Ahead
While the prospect of autonomous rides is thrilling, the rollout has already encountered its share of challenges and uncertainties. The initial batch of robotaxis will comprise approximately ten 2025 Model Y SUVs operating within a carefully defined service area in South Austin. This deliberately limited approach reflects a cautious strategy to manage risk as Tesla amplifies its commitment to fully autonomous driving.
Reports from industry experts, including Ed Niedermeyer, a prominent author and commentator on Tesla, shed light on what’s happening behind the scenes. Niedermeyer recently identified a site in South Austin that appears to function as a Tesla robotaxi depot, suggesting that the vehicles are already being prepared for operation. Observations of the Model Y SUVs, complete with employees behind the wheel, entering and exiting the premises offer potential insights into how Tesla is managing this early stage of its autonomous services.
Interestingly, some of these robotaxis exhibited erratic behavior during initial drives—one instance involved a vehicle suddenly applying its brakes multiple times, even in the middle of intersections. While the specific motivations behind these maneuvers remain unclear, such observations serve to highlight the complexities involved in deploying self-driving technology in real-world scenarios.
### Information Transparency and Company Strategy
Leading up to this launch, details have been somewhat sporadic. Much of what is currently known has been gleaned from conversations with Tesla supporters rather than through formal disclosures by the company. In fact, there have been allegations that Tesla has attempted to suppress information regarding its robotaxi service, including efforts to restrict public records requests related to its operations.
Tesla emphasizes an ethos of transparency, yet it appears reluctant to disclose certain critical information about its autonomous vehicle initiatives. This hesitance raises questions about the company’s commitment to comprehensive communication during a time when public trust and safety are paramount concerns for users of new technologies.
One notable strategy mentioned is the inclusion of a human safety monitor within each robotaxi. This decision opens up inquiries regarding the role these individuals will play during rides, as it remains uncertain what level of control they might have over the vehicles. Historical practices in the autonomous vehicle sector have traditionally involved a human operator behind the wheel alongside an engineer in the passenger seat during testing phases. With this new rollout, however, that paradigm is being altered as Tesla moves to commercial operations.
### The Technology Behind the Robotaxi
Contrary to some expectations, Tesla has opted not to utilize the futuristic “Cybercab” vehicles initially showcased in 2024. Instead, the operational fleet will rely on the more familiar 2025 Model Y, featuring what Musk describes as an “unsupervised” version of Tesla’s Full Self-Driving software. This shift in focus has potential implications for how the software is expected to handle complex driving scenarios.
Significantly, Tesla’s approach will not leverage the in-cabin camera during rides unless specific circumstances warrant it, such as emergency situations. The company maintains that the camera will be activated post-ride to ensure the robotaxi is prepared for subsequent trips.
Amidst this rollout, Tesla encourages early access riders to document their experiences, promoting user-generated content related to their robotaxi rides. However, this encouragement comes with caveats: riders must adhere to strict guidelines, and any violation—such as engaging in illegal activities or distributing content that misrepresents the robotaxi—could lead to termination of service.
### Community Feedback and Early Experiences
As the new service began, reactions from initial riders provided an invaluable glimpse into the early performance of Tesla’s robotaxis. Many reported smooth rides, although there were also concerns when remote support became necessary during certain trips. This blend of excitement and cautious skepticism reflects the broader public sentiment surrounding autonomous vehicles, where optimism coexists with valid fears about the reliability of new technologies.
Musk and other Tesla executives have publicly celebrated this milestone, expressing gratitude towards their engineering teams for the successful launch. However, the mixed responses from riders suggest that while the technology has made significant advancements, there remains a lot to learn and optimize as real-world challenges continue to surface.
